Fresh Spring Rolls
Meet the owner of Bambύ
Restaurant in Maplewood as she
shares the secret to making fresh
spring rolls, one of the restaurant’s
best sellers. Although they are
considered simple, they can be
challenging to get right and it takes
a zen-like balance to really make
them memorable. Once you learn,
you will be able to pass on Yin’s
lovely, elegant recipe and technique
for generations of your own family!
Make 4 spring rolls plus take home a
bottle of the amazing Bambύ Peanut
Sauce. Yin Thong

NEW Secrets of
Memorable Soups
With cold weather approaching,
it's time to take your soup-making
to the next level! Learn to pick
the best meats and vegetables for
hearty autumn-winter soups, why
you seldom need to use stock, how
to build soups by layers, and the
pots and kitchen tools that make
soup preparation more efficient and
enjoyable. You will make three soups
during class. Bring your favorite soup
pot, towel scrubby or dishcloth,
chef's knife and three containers for
leftovers. $10 food fee is payable in
class. Jan Zita Grover
